WebA truck driver can expect a salary of $45,000 to $80,000 a year, considering the Hours of Service Regulations set by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) in the … WebJul 21, 2009 · Our tax laws allow taxpayers a deduction for car and truck expenses. Taxpayers can elect to deduct actual costs or estimate the cost using the standard mileage rates. These rules are different for truck drivers. Truck drivers have to use actual costs. They cannot rely on standard mileage rates. Truck Drivers Who Use Passenger Vehicles
WebJan 20, 2024 · Common Truck Driver Tax Deductions. If you received a W-2 from a freight hauling company, the IRS will not allow you to deduct job-related expenses. However, self-employed truckers or those operating under a lease purchase arrangement will be pleased to discover many of the usual deductions remain in place. These include the following.
